Restoring a Night Owl DVR to factory settings requires either a software-based administrative reset via the local interface or a hardware-level recovery depending on the specific model architecture. This process removes custom configurations, network settings, and user passwords, necessitating a complete re-initialization of the surveillance environment to regain administrative access or troubleshoot persistent system stability issues.


Pre-Procedure Requirements and Technical Prerequisites

Before initiating a system reset, verify the physical architecture of your DVR unit. Night Owl DVRs vary significantly between legacy analog systems, hybrid digital video recorders, and newer network-based security solutions. A reset is a destructive process that clears the drive partitions and restores the firmware to its original state; it will not delete the actual surveillance footage on your hard drive, but it will disconnect the system from your remote monitoring applications and cloud accounts.

Step-by-Step Technical Execution for System Restoration



Step 1: Navigating to the System Maintenance Interface

Connect your DVR to a dedicated monitor using an HDMI or VGA cable and plug in the USB mouse to the unit. Right-click anywhere on the live view screen to trigger the context menu. Navigate to the main menu by selecting the gear icon or the Menu option. Enter your administrative credentials when prompted. If you are locked out due to a forgotten password, proceed to the hardware trigger section described later. Navigate to the System or Maintenance tab, usually represented by an icon of a wrench or a settings folder.



Step 2: Executing the Factory Default Restoration

Within the Maintenance menu, locate the sub-menu labeled Factory Reset, Default, or Restore Defaults. You will often see checkboxes that allow you to choose what exactly you wish to reset. To perform a comprehensive recovery, ensure all checkboxes, such as Network Settings, Camera Settings, and User Accounts, are selected. Click the Apply or Reset button. The system will prompt you for a final confirmation.

Warning: Do not interrupt the power supply while the system is processing the reset. An interruption during the firmware re-initialization phase can lead to a corrupted bootloader, effectively bricking the DVR and requiring a factory-level flash that is not user-serviceable.



Step 3: Performing a Hard Reset via Password Recovery Protocol

If you are locked out of the interface, Night Owl DVRs utilize a security code system based on the system date. When the login screen appears, look for a "Forgot Password" or "Security Question" option. If unavailable, attempt to input the date currently displayed on the screen into the Night Owl password recovery tool available on the manufacturer's official support portal. This generates a temporary override key. Input this key into the password field to bypass the lock and navigate to the system settings to perform the standard factory reset.



Step 4: Post-Reset Initialization and Network Re-configuration

Once the system reboots, it will initiate the Setup Wizard. Follow the on-screen prompts to set the local time zone, date, and, most importantly, the new administrative password. Ensure you establish a complex alphanumeric password to prevent unauthorized access. Finally, navigate to the Network Settings menu to set a static IP address or enable DHCP to ensure the DVR can communicate with the Night Owl mobile application and cloud services.

Troubleshooting Common Reset and Connectivity Failures



  • Failure: System reboots but fails to load the GUI.

    • Root Cause: Firmware fragmentation or hardware-level logic error during the reset sequence.
    • Actionable Fix: Perform a hard power cycle by unplugging the power cable for 60 seconds. If the error persists, inspect the HDMI cable integrity and ensure the resolution output of the DVR matches your monitor's native input.
  • Failure: Password recovery code is rejected.

    • Root Cause: Time-stamping mismatch between the DVR's internal CMOS battery clock and the recovery utility.
    • Actionable Fix: Ensure the date displayed on the DVR login screen exactly matches the date input into the password generator. If the date is stuck on a default year (e.g., 2000), replace the internal coin-cell battery on the motherboard.
  • Failure: DVR does not appear on the mobile application after reset.

    • Root Cause: The reset reverted the DVR to default network settings, breaking the static IP mapping or cloud handshake.
    • Actionable Fix: Re-scan the QR code found under the System Info or QR Code menu on the DVR interface using the mobile application's "Add Device" function to re-establish the P2P connection.

Frequently Asked Questions



Will a factory reset delete my recorded security footage?

A standard factory reset on a Night Owl DVR impacts the configuration, user accounts, and network parameters, but it typically does not format the internal Hard Disk Drive (HDD). Your previously recorded files remain intact, although you may need to re-index the drive via the Storage menu to make them visible to the playback interface after the reset.



Can I reset the DVR without a monitor and mouse?

Most Night Owl DVR systems are designed as standalone embedded units that require direct local interaction via a monitor and USB mouse. It is generally not possible to perform a complete factory reset via a remote web browser or mobile app, as the security protocols require physical verification of the device.



How do I recover a forgotten administrative password?

You must use the specific Security Code generated by the Night Owl password recovery utility. This utility requires the specific date showing on your DVR screen and the model number of your device. Always ensure your device firmware is updated to the latest version to maintain compatibility with modern password recovery tools.



What should I do if the reset button on the back of the device doesn't work?

Some units feature a recessed pinhole reset button. You must use a paperclip or SIM-eject tool to press and hold this button for at least 15 to 30 seconds while the unit is powered on. If this fails to trigger a reset, the internal switch may be damaged, and you must rely on the software-based password recovery override through the GUI.
